Here’s a break down of the the price gouging, that’s almost criminal and the alternative that will save you almost 50%.
Bell
- Monthly Fee: $47.95/month.
- Modem Fee: $3/month. (You pay this fee even if you own a DSL modem).
- Bandwidth: 60 Gigabyte Monthly Bandwidth Cap.
- 60 GBs can add up very quickly in this day and age of iTunes, Youtube, Anderson Cooper 360, Larry King, Bill O’Reilly highlights, Treehouse TV and various other popular media related activities online. - Speed: 7Mbits/second
The CHEAP alternative
Teksavvy.com
- Canadian company based out of Chatham, Ontario.
- Monthly Fee: $29.95/month — see below to get an additional $2/month discount.
- Modem Fee: $0 – if you own your own DSL modem. If you don’t own a DSL modem, Teksavvy provides two very affordable options:
- Rent to own option – $25 One time setup fee + $10/month for 6 months.
- One time purchase price option – $75.
- You can also find DSL modems at cheap prices on online classifieds websites like Craigslist and Kijiji. - Bandwidth: 200 Gigabytes of Monthly Bandwidth.
- This is average of two months — so if you used 300 GBs 1 month, as long as the consumption for the following monthly is below 100 GB you are not exceeding your usage. - Speed: 5 Mbits/second
- The difference between 5Mbit and 7Mbit speed translates into downloading a file at approximately 510Kilobytes/second instead of 700 Kilobytes/second. The average user will not notice the difference in speed. When your internet speed gets this high, the difference is negligible. - $27.95/month discount price for those who’ve signed up for a GroupBuy Discount (55% of what Bell Charges for the same high speed internet service, with 3 times the monthly bandwidth).
$50.95 – $27.95 = $23.00/month.
$23 x 12 months = $276 for the year
$276 + 13 % (5 GST + 8 PST) = $311.88/year savings!
The Process
- Call Teksavvy’s toll free number listed on their website 1-877-779-1575
- Informed the rep, you are currently a Bell customer and wish to switch to Teksavvy for their high speed internet access.
- If you have already purchased a modem on Craigslist, Kijiji or elsewhere, inform the rep you own your modem already. If not, Select 1 of the two available options as detailed above.
- Once the billing information has been collected, your account will be setup by the rep.
- Once the account is setup, call Bell and cancel your service.
- Enjoy Teksavvy’s highspeed internet service and the $300+ of savings annually.
